Try net-snmp v4.2.x

v5.x has a lot of changes that we haven't mapped to as yet.

> I installed net-snmp (ver 5.0.2.pre1) and nagios (ver 1.0b4) on Solaris
> (2.8),  both nagios and net-snmp are working fine (check_ping, check_dns,
> etc..and snmpwalk, snmpget, etc..are working), but I have trouble to use
> check_snmp.
>  
> Here's part of my snmp.conf file
> mibdirs  /usr/local/share/snmp/mibs
> mibs +ALTEON-PRIVATE-MIBS
>  
> Here's snmpget output
> $snmpget -c public 1.1.1.1 .1.3.6.1.4.1.1872.2.1.8.12.2.0
> ALTEON-PRIVATE-MIBS::memStatsFrees.0 = Counter32: 152637538
>  
> Here's the check_snmp output
> $check_snmp -H 1.1.1.1 -o .1.3.6.1.4.1.1872.2.1.8.12.2.0 -w 100000000 -c
> 50000000 -C public
> SNMP problem - No data recieved from host
> CMD: /usr/local/bin/snmpget -m ALL -v 1 172.16.64.5 public
> .1.3.6.1.4.1.1872.2.1.8.12.2.0
